What are the symmetries of a cube?

From the perspective of a symmetry group, a cube has 48 symmetries total. They include:

  • 24 rotational symmetries:
    • the identity
    • 6 90° rotations about axes through the centers of opposite faces
    • 3 180° rotations about the same axes
    • 8 120° rotations about the space diagonals connecting opposite vertices
    • 6 180° rotations about axes through the centers of opposite edges
  • 24 reflection symmetries that involve one of the above rotations, followed (or, equivalently) preceded by the same reflection
